Despite a brave first-half performance, the Indian men's football team lost to host China 1-5 in their opening group game at the 19th Asian Games on Tuesday at the Huanglong Sports Centre Stadium, in Hangzhou.

Teenage Indian rifle shooter Nischal won a silver medal in the Women’s 50m Rifle 3 Positions (3P) at the International Shooting Sport Federation (ISSF) World Cup Rifle/Pistol stage in Rio De Janeiro, Brazil, on Monday to give India a second medal on the final day of the tournament.
